Understanding the Economic and Cultural Impact of Bee Productivity
As the world relies heavily on pollinators for crop growth, maintaining healthy bee populations is crucial for food security and economic stability. In the United States alone, bees contribute to $20 billion of agricultural revenue annually. The impact of a thriving bee colony extends beyond the economy, though, to encompass community building, environmental conservation, and a deeper connection with nature.

Diversity is the Key: Incorporating Local and Exotic Flora
A diverse range of flora in and around the hive is crucial for maintaining healthy populations. By incorporating both local and exotic plant species, beekeepers can create a thriving ecosystem that caters to the complex needs of their bees.
Diseases such as Varroa mites and American Foulbrood threaten bee colonies worldwide. Innovative disease management strategies, such as targeted treatments and integrated pest control methods, help combat these threats and safeguard the health of your colony.
Timing is everything when it comes to nectar flow. By aligning bloom times with peak nectar production, beekeepers can provide their colony with the sustenance it needs to thrive. A mix of local and exotic flora ensures that nectar sources are continuously available.
As climate change continues to impact global weather patterns, bee colonies face unprecedented challenges. Understanding the interconnectedness of environmental conditions and colony health allows beekeepers to proactively adapt to changing circumstances and maintain resilience.
From precision agriculture to smart hives, advanced technology is revolutionizing the world of beekeeping. By leveraging these tools, beekeepers can optimize pollination strategies, monitor colony health, and access valuable data to inform their decision-making.
